Angular dependence of the levitation force on a small magnet above a superconducting cylinder in the Meissner state

Abstract

The dipole–dipole interaction model was used to calculate the levitation force on a small permanent magnet above a superconducting cylinder in the Meissner state lying on the cylinder's axis. We obtained analytical expressions for the levitation force and energy in terms of the physical dimensions of the cylindrical superconductor as well as the height and the angle between the magnetic moment and the surface of the sample. Results show that the levitation force and energy are maxima when the magnetic moment is perpendicular to the surface and minima when it is parallel. Special cases of infinite radius and infinite thickness were discussed.
